U.S. Coast Guard Approved
This course is designed for mariners who do not previously hold a CG License
An applicant who successfully complets this 94-hour Master Not More Than 100 Gross Tons course and presents his/her Certificate of Training at a Regional Exam Center within one year of completion of training, will satisfy the examination requirements of 46 CFR 10.205(I) for original issuance or 46 CFR 10.209 ( C) (iii) for renewal of license as Master or Mate of Steam or Motor Vessels Not More Than 100 Gross tons (except ocean). This course covers the subjects and practical knowledge to perform as Master 25, 50, 100 GT, Near Coastal. covered topics include: license structure, rules of the road, watch-standing, navigation, shiphandling, emergency procedures, first aid, firefighting, pollution and National Maritime Law.
